About the role

Here at Cavendish Nuclear we are looking to employ an experienced HVAC engineer who will be integral to the successful construction of Hinkley Point C as part of the MEH Alliance. The MEH Alliance ia a collective of the most esteemed construction, engineering and nuclear organisations joining forces to deliver the largest construction taking place in Europe right now. This is a once in a career opportunity to be a part of the first new nuclear power station to be built in the UK in over 20 years. Hinkley Point C in Somerset will provide low-carbon electricity for around 6 million homes and bring lasting benefits to the UK economy.

Job Purpose:

The successful candidates will responsible for the construction engineering works for the HVAC equipment installation and experienced in writing installation procedure documentation. This includes the delegation of responsibilities to CE's/Works Coordination Leads in order to Lead, manage and motivate the team through implementation of best practice. Ultimately you will be accountable to deliver Discipline Specific Construction Work Pack scope of works to support the MEH construction activities
